PHILADELPHIA, PA — The Philadelphia Phillies will host the Minnesota Twins this Sunday at 3:05 p.m. ET, in a crucial game as both teams head towards the end of the season. The Phillies stand as favorites with a moneyline of -208 against the underdog Twins at +174, with a run-line set at -1.5.

Philadelphia enters the game with a record of 6-4 and an average of 4.8 runs per game, buoyed by 20 home runs this season and a solid earned run average (ERA) of 3.50. In contrast, the struggling Twins hold a 3-7 record, scoring just 3.3 runs per game with only 9 home runs and a higher ERA of 5.01.

In the starting lineup, Phillies pitcher Aaron Nola is aiming to turn his season around, after allowing 29 runs in his last 36.2 innings. He faces Minnesota’s Joe Ryan, who also has had difficulties on the mound, surrendering 23 runs over his last 27 innings.
